COOKEVILLE – Mallory Doyle has joined First Freedom Bank as a customer service representative at the bank’s Cookeville office.

Doyle was previously employed with Lynx Incorporated in Indianapolis as an account manager. While in that position, she earned the “Highest Sales for the Company” award and the “Boss’ Right Hand Man” award. This award is given to an employee that shows the most initiative and drive.

The Cookeville branch, formally FSG Bank, is located at 376 W. Jackson St.

“We are very pleased to have Mallory as a member of the First Freedom team,” Kenny Beavers, senior vice president and director of retail banking, said. “She possesses excellent customer service skills, and always greets the customer with a warm smile and a friendly hello.”

Doyle graduated from Lebanon High School in 2014. She was born and raised in Watertown and currently resides in Cookeville.

First Freedom Bank, headquartered in Wilson County, was established in 2006. A full service, community bank, First Freedom Bank offers personal and commercial banking services from six locations in Wilson, Putnam and Jackson counties, and has approximately 70 employees. First Freedom Bank has assets in excess of $420 million and is owned by more than 1,100 shareholders from Wilson and surrounding counties.
